Customizing Your Notifications for Optimal Engagement
The effectiveness of push notifications hinges on the ability to tailor them to individual preferences. Generic alerts that blast out information about every event quickly become annoying and are often ignored. Instead, platforms should allow users to specify which teams, leagues, and players they want to follow, and which types of events they want to be notified about. For example, a fan might want to receive notifications only when their favorite team scores a goal, or when a specific player enters the game. Sophisticated platforms also offer advanced customization options, such as the ability to set time-based notifications or to filter notifications based on their urgency. This level of control ensures that fans receive timely and relevant information, maximizing their engagement and keeping them connected to the sports they love.

Utilizing Statistical Models and Predictive Analytics
Beyond simple descriptive statistics, many platforms are now incorporating sophisticated statistical models and predictive analytics. These tools use algorithms to forecast future outcomes based on historical data and current conditions. For example, a platform might use a predictive model to estimate the probability of a team winning a game, or to project a player’s future performance. While these predictions are not always accurate, they can provide valuable insights and help fans identify potential opportunities. Understanding the limitations of these models is also crucial; they are based on assumptions and can be affected by unforeseen events. However, when used responsibly, data analytics and predictive modeling can significantly enhance the sports fan experience, providing a more nuanced and informed perspective.
